Inclusion Criteria

1.Adults aged 18 years or over
2.Admitted to hospital with a diagnosis of community-acquired pneumonia. Pneumonia will be based on a clinical definition as follows: the presence of at least 2 of the following signs and symptoms for less than 14 days: cough, fever, dyspnoea, haemoptysis, chest pain or crackles on chest examination.
3.Admitted to hospital within the previous 48 hours
4.Provides written informed consent

Exclusion Criteria

1.Hospital acquired pneumonia- defined as pneumonia in a patient who has been in hospital for >48 hours who did not have the symptoms at admission
2.Patients who in the opinion of the attending clinician, require to be treated with steroids.
3.Known or suspected condition which in the opinion of attending clinician requires treatment with steroids, including but not limited to ch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, asthma, adrenal insufficiency, Pneumocystis Jirovecii pneumonia (PCP).
4.If the clinician strongly suspects COVID-19 and wants to provide steroids to the patient because of this suspicion, then the patient will be excluded from the trial.
5.Pregnancy or breast feeding
6.Any contraindication to steroid administration
7.Diagnosis of COVID-19 confirmed via PCR of NP/OP swabs (this only applies if test result known at the point of enrollment)
